Overall Meaning

The lyrics of Noah Slee's song "Golden" capture the singer's self-reflection and growth after a painful breakup. The singer begins by acknowledging that the signs of a deteriorating relationship were apparent but perhaps not obvious enough to warrant attention. Their individuality and emotions were at odds, leaving the relationship to wither away. The singer sees this as an opportunity to learn from and unlearn certain behaviors, which were preventing growth. The use of the word "golden" is a metaphor for self-discovery and self-realization as the singer sifts through the "trauma" and pieces together memories that will "stand the test of time."


The singer reminisces about their childhood and how those formative years shape who they become. They learn to confront or bury past memories, and it isn't always easy to reconcile with the past. There are times of uncertainty and confusion when they feel lost, but they know they must keep moving forward. The singer acknowledges their newfound clarity and desire to take charge of their life without having to wait in line. The final verses are about accepting the consequences of their actions while appreciating the lessons learned.
